以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  [求助]扩展-多文件中的输入  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=89173)

--  作者:wangyinming
--  发布时间:2016/8/16 16:54:00
--  [求助]扩展-多文件中的输入
[求助]扩展-多文件的列中数据只能手工输入吗?我想用类似 自动输入的实现 的功能。
但是同一型号有2个不同的号码,怎么可以填入呢?现在是手工添加的。


2 2DACF028G-2 E18257B 2 E18257B-2.PDF
3 2DACF028G-2 E18258B 2 E18258B-2.PDF


                        多文件后的列
2DACF028G-2 E18257B-2.PDF
                        E18258B-2.pdf





If e.DataCol.Name = "型号" Then \'发生变化的是型号列吗?
    Dim dr As DataRow
    dr = DataTables("模具图").Find("型号 = \'" & e.DataRow("型号") & "\'" ) \'在工程表中找到型号列    
    If dr IsNot Nothing \'如果找到, 则设置各列内容
        e.DataRow("模具图")= dr("模具图")
    End If
End If





图片点击可在新窗口打开查看此主题相关图片如下:捕获.png
图片点击可在新窗口打开查看

图片点击可在新窗口打开查看此主题相关图片如下:捕获2.png
图片点击可在新窗口打开查看

图片点击可在新窗口打开查看此主题相关图片如下:无标题.jpg
图片点击可在新窗口打开查看
[此贴子已经被作者于2016/8/16 17:01:22编辑过]

--  作者:大红袍
--  发布时间:2016/8/16 17:13:00
--  

 

If e.DataCol.Name = "型号" Then \'发生变化的是型号列吗?
    e.DataRow("模具图") = DataTables("模具图").GetComboListString("模具图", "型号 = \'" & e.DataRow("型号") & "\'" ).replace("|", vbcrlf) \'在工程表中找到型号列
End If